In furtherance of the purposes of this chapter and in implementation of the powers and duties provided in this chapter, the department has the following additional powers and duties:
1.To formulate policies for the selection, acquisition, use, management, and protection of
nature preserves.
2.To determine, supervise, and control the management of nature preserves and to
make, publish, and amend reasonable rules necessary or advisable for the use and
protection of nature preserves and for the business of the department.
3.To encourage and recommend the dedication of natural areas as nature preserves.
